SparkSessionOptions Class

SparkSessionOptions.

All required parameters must be populated in order to send to Azure.

Inheritance
SparkSessionOptions

Constructor

SparkSessionOptions(*, name: str, tags: Optional[Dict[str, str]] = None, artifact_id: Optional[str] = None, file: Optional[str] = None, class_name: Optional[str] = None, arguments: Optional[List[str]] = None, jars: Optional[List[str]] = None, python_files: Optional[List[str]] = None, files: Optional[List[str]] = None, archives: Optional[List[str]] = None, configuration: Optional[Dict[str, str]] = None, driver_memory: Optional[str] = None, driver_cores: Optional[int] = None, executor_memory: Optional[str] = None, executor_cores: Optional[int] = None, executor_count: Optional[int] = None, **kwargs)

Parameters

tags
dict[str, str]
Required

A set of tags. Dictionary of <string>.

artifact_id
str
Required
name
str
Required

Required.

file
str
Required
class_name
str
Required
arguments
list[str]
Required
jars
list[str]
Required
python_files
list[str]
Required
files
list[str]
Required
archives
list[str]
Required
configuration
dict[str, str]
Required

Dictionary of <string>.

driver_memory
str
Required
driver_cores
int
Required
executor_memory
str
Required
executor_cores
int
Required
executor_count
int
Required